Antonio de Curtis, known as “Totò”, is considered one of the greatest actors of the 20th century, having aroused the admiration of major filmmakers of his time and of the public. A comic, burlesque, grotesque, sometimes provocative figure, but also light and sublime, the singular art of Totò was able to express itself both in cinema and in theater. This thesis of cinematographic studies is based on anthropological and historical elements in order to analyze the Totò phenomenon in all these dimensions. The study of the Neapolitan roots of the actor makes it possible to appreciate all the richness of Totò’s acting and gestures, exemplified in the first sketch of "L'Or de Naples" where he performs a pazzariello. This carnival theme is filled with analyzes of roles specifically linked to Neapolitan culture and, in this culture, of laughter, irony and derision. Indeed, these keys of reading and interpretation open up an understanding of the undoubted success of Totò with an audience that perceives all its subtlety

Waxworks were not always the cheap sensation spinners as which we perceive them today. Before the invention and wide-spread use of photography and illustrated magazines they were an important medium for distributing visual information. No other form of communication could offer such immediate representations the protagonists of world history. Perhaps the greatest part in their success took the material wax which allowed the creation of deceptively lifelike and hitherto most realistic depictions of celebrated individuals. In this thesis, Madame Tussaud’s serves as a prime example for examining the mode of operation of a waxwork exhibition. As far as the sources allow, the itinerary, the ‘cast’ and display of the exhibition is reconstructed, as well as the number and the social background of its visitors during the first half of the 19th century. It emerges that Marie Tussaud was a talented portrait artist and a show woman of ambition whose carefully constructed exhibition attracted mainly middle-class visitors with an interest in human classification. Thus, the waxworks was a ‘rational entertainment’ that was thought to further the development of knowledge and character in its visitors. While Madame Tussaud’s was perhaps the most famous waxworks, it was not the first one. The history of commercial exhibition of life-sized wax figures goes back to the 17th century. Their concept, however, changed significantly over the centuries. Three forms of waxworks are differentiated here: a) the baroque waxworks of groups of figures narrating programmatic and allegorical stories, b) the enlightened portrait gallery – such as Madame Tussaud’s – where celebrities are presented as individual characters, c) the modern tableau waxworks, that represents extraordinary as well as everyday events in a realistic way that was hitherto unprecedented. As a channel for the distribution of news and as a medium for representing reality waxworks have become outdated. As a tickle for the senses, however, they will yet remain effective.
